Credit this piece by copying the following to your credits section: Rains Will Fall Kevin MacLeod (incompetech.com) "Rains Will Fall" Instruments: Piano, Kit, Strings Feel: Calming, Somber, Uplifting Slow Waltz. English Waltz. Foxtrot. Slow Fox. The piano plays a mournful, waltzing melody, while strings enter gently. Halfway into the second minute, the tone is more hopeful, but then returns to the sadness of the introduction. Just before the third minute ends the hope returns, but melts again into sadness with the final high note of the piano. This is music for a rainy day, or when the hero to a story has lost his way.
